Column of Light


Commissioned through Oregon’s Percent for Art in Public Places Program, To Scale the Scales of Justice references figurative classics of art history, while presenting the artist’s contemporary interpretation of the symbols of protection and balance practiced within the walls of this Justice Building.

Farfalla e Crissalide

Farfalla e Crissalide (Butterfly with Chrysalis)
Italian Bardiglio Nuvolato Marble and White Carrara Marble on a Columbia River Basalt Base.
8' x 2' x 2'
Commission for Wellspring, a Silverton Hospital wellness center in Woodburn, Oregon
Consultant: Naomi Coplin, Clark/Kjos Architects
Installed 2006
